다음을 통해 공유


IDXGISwapChainMedia::CheckPresentDurationSupport 메서드(dxgi1_3.h)

그래픽 드라이버에서 사용자 지정 새로 고침 빈도에 해당하는 지원되는 프레임 현재 기간을 쿼리합니다.

구문

HRESULT CheckPresentDurationSupport(
        UINT DesiredPresentDuration,
  [out] UINT *pClosestSmallerPresentDuration,
  [out] UINT *pClosestLargerPresentDuration
);

매개 변수

DesiredPresentDuration

검사 프레임 기간을 나타냅니다. 이 값은 수백 나노초 단위로 지정된 원하는 새로 고침 속도로 한 프레임의 기간입니다. 예를 들어 이 필드를 60Hz 새로 고침 속도 지원을 위해 검사 167777 설정합니다.

[out] pClosestSmallerPresentDuration

요청된 값보다 작은 지원되는 가장 가까운 프레임 현재 기간으로 설정되거나 디바이스가 더 낮은 기간을 지원하지 않는 경우 0으로 설정되는 변수입니다.

[out] pClosestLargerPresentDuration

요청된 값보다 큰 지원되는 가장 가까운 프레임 현재 기간으로 설정되거나 디바이스가 더 높은 기간을 지원하지 않는 경우 0으로 설정되는 변수입니다.

반환 값

이 메서드는 성공 시 S_OK 반환하거나 실패 시 DXGI 오류 코드를 반환합니다.

설명

DXGI 출력 어댑터가 사용자 지정 새로 고침 속도(예: 외부 디스플레이)를 지원하지 않는 경우 디스플레이 드라이버는 상한 및 하한을 (0, 0)으로 설정합니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ows 8.1 [데스크톱 앱만 해당]
지원되는 최소 서버 R2 Windows Server 2012 [데스크톱 앱만 해당]
대상 플랫폼 Windows
헤더 dxgi1_3.h
라이브러리 Dxgi.lib

추가 정보

IDXGISwapChainMedia